Key Responsibilities
Accurately pull, scan, package, and stage orders for delivery
Receive shipments and stock inventory in designated warehouse locations
Stack, wrap, and load/unload trucks safely and efficiently
Use pallet jacks, forklifts, order pickers, and other equipment (training provided)
Ensure correct parts and quantities are handled at every step
Communicate clearly with peers and supervisors to ensure workflow success
Maintain cleanliness and follow all safety protocols
Perform other warehouse tasks as assigned based on daily needs
Qualifications
18 years of age or older
Ability to lift up to 75 lbs consistently
Comfortable standing, walking, bending, and climbing ladders all day
Ability to work safely at heights up to 30 feet
Strong attention to detail in a fast‑paced, accuracy‑driven environment
Reliable and punctual with a strong work ethic
Comfortable working in a non–climate‑controlled warehouse (seasonal temperature variations)
Experience with forklift or other pallet‑in‑transit equipment (preferred)
